Keyless Entry Systems

A lot of modern cars have keyless entry systems that allow you to unlock and lock your doors without using a physical key. These systems can include key fobs or biometric scanners, touchpads or other new technologies.

These Car replacement key security systems work by transmitting radio signals between the key fob and your car. If the key fob is within range of the vehicle, it transmits an unique code to identify it to the car's computer. The car computer detects the digital identification and opens or locks the doors by relying on the digital ID. Keyless entry systems offer more security and convenience than traditional keys. There are apps for smartphones that let you control the locks of a keyless entry system.

While keyless entry systems are more secure and convenient than keys, they have some drawbacks. For instance they are susceptible to hacking. A replay attack is the most common method to steal data from keyless entry systems. This involves recording and analyzing the signal generated by your key fob, then repeating it back to the receiver. Certain car replacement keys near me security systems employ the cipher Keeloq to protect against these attacks.

Another disadvantage of keyless entry systems is that they can sometimes be susceptible to issues and glitches. If you're having trouble with a keyless system, begin by replacing the battery in your key fob or transmitter. This is often a solution to problems that have limited range or intermittent response.

Key Cylinders

While key fobs receive all the attention, traditional keys are still used in some cars. These are the blade-style keys that fit in the ignition cylinders of older models. They are generally cheaper than chip-key replacements. A standard key replacement will cost about $10.

Cylinders can be used to lock or unlock trunks, doors and other. They comprise a small opening that accepts keys to lock or unlock a piece of hardware, and have pins that block or create a shear line if the key is inserted correctly. The ridges on your keys are aligned with these pins, which allows you to cut or raise the shear line. These wafers may be damaged or broken by worn keys so a locksmith may need to repair the lock.

A standard operating key can be used to operate a traditional lock cylinder. For additional security and performance, you can upgrade to a security cylinder. This upgrade involves adding one or more master pins to the existing pins, creating an additional shear line that only the key with this combination can create. This kind of cylinder can be retrofitted into many types of mortise locksets, door hardware configurations, as well as cylindrical panic devices.
